I saw Blue Oyster Cult at the Norwester 76 festival in Stateline, Idaho, on June 4, 1976. I was, as they say, in an altered mental status. Lucy in the Sky with Diamonds. It was an awesome show! Unfortunately, the promoter ran off with the money, and when the bands realized they weren't going to get paid, they all packed up and left. Then the fans figured out that there wasn't going to be any more music, and a riot ensued. My brother and I helped BOC get their stuff off the stage before the rioters destroyed it all.
